Maine colleges listed among top schools

By Kelley Bouchard Portland Press Herald Staff Writer August 22, 2008 05:46 PM

Several Maine schools made the 2009 Best Colleges list published today by U.S. News and World Report on its Web site.

Bowdoin College in Brunswick ranked No. 6 among the nation's liberal arts colleges, followed by Colby College in Waterville at No. 23 and Bates College in Lewiston at No. 24. College of the Atlantic in Bar Harbor made the list as a Tier 3 liberal arts school.

Maine Maritime Academy in Castine ranked No. 10 among bachelor's degree-granting schools in the Northeast, followed by the University of Maine at Farmington at No. 18. Unity College and the University of Maine at Fort Kent made the list among Tier 3 bachelor's degree-schools in the region, followed by Thomas College in Waterville and the University of Maine at Augusta among Tier 4 schools.

The University of New England in Portland and Biddeford ranked 81 among universities in the Northeast that offer undergraduate and some master's degree program but few doctoral programs.

The magazine will be available on newsstands Monday.
